PURPOSE: Historically, the role of adjuvant radiotherapy (RT) for patients with adrenocortical carcinoma (ACC) has been controversial. The objective of this research is to review systematically the literature evaluating the role of adjuvant RT in patients with ACC undergone a surgical resection. MATERIALS AND METHODS: The electronic databases were searched for articles published until July 2017 without language restriction: Lilacs, Medline, Embase, and the Cochrane. Two reviewers independently appraised the eligibility criteria and extracted data. When possible, a fixed-effect meta-analysis was done. The systematic review (SR) followed all the criteria of the MOOSE guideline. RESULTS: Overall, 382 citations were identified. After the screening of titles and abstracts, 12 articles (eight case series [48 patients] and 4 cohort studies [136 patients]) were included in the final analysis. For the local recurrence, the pooled relative risk (RR) was RR = 0.46 (95% confidence interval: 0.28-0.75), in favor of adjuvant RT when compared with surgery alone. Concerning overall mortality and disease recurrence, no significant difference between adjuvant RT and surgery was detected, RR = 0.77 (CI 95% 0.49-1.22, P = 0.27), and RR = 0.95 (IC 95% 0.74-1.24, P = 0.67). In all cohort studies, the acute toxicities were graduated as mild and self-limited with nausea and fatigue being the most common symptoms. Only one case (1/50) of impairment of kidney function was detected as late toxicity in these studies. CONCLUSIONS: This SR and meta-analysis indicate that adjuvant RT dramatically reduces the local recurrence of ACC after surgery. Moreover, the treatment has a low acute and late toxicity, resulting in a high therapeutic index. Further, prospective studies are needed to confirm or refute the role of RT on survival and disease recurrence.

OBJECTIVE: The intention of this study is to compare whole brain radiotherapy and stereotactic radiosurgery (WBRT + SRS) with WBRT in patients with 1-4 brain metastases to find a subgroup of patients that have a great benefit with aggressive treatment. MATERIALS AND METHODS: Between December 2002 and December 2013, 60 patients with 1-4 brain metastases were treated by WBRT + SRS. In this period, 60 patients treated with WBRT were matched with patients treated with WBRT + SRS. RESULTS: The median survival for the entire cohort was 8.3 months. In the univariate analysis, WBRT + SRS (0.031), the presence of extracranial disease (P = 0.02), Karnofsky performance score <70 (P = 0.0001), and age >65 (P = 0.001) years were significant factors for survival. In the entire cohort, the median survival for recursive partitioning analysis (RPA) classes I, II, and III was 11, 7, and 3 months, respectively (P = 0.0001). In a stratified analysis, only RPA class I achieved statistical significance for 1-year survival between the groups (WBRT + SRS = 51% and WBRT = 23%, P = 0.03). Cox regression analysis revealed WBRT + SRS, age >65 years, and extracranial disease as independent prognostic factors. In the univariate analysis, lesion volume ≤5 cm 3 (P = 0.002) and WBRT + SRS (P = 0.003) were the significant factors associated with better brain control. CONCLUSION: WBRT plus SRS was an independent prognostic factor for survival. However, the combined treatment appears to be justified only in patients with RPA I and lesion volume ≤5 cm 3, independently of the number of lesions.

BACKGROUND: The objective of this article was to report the results from a randomized clinical trial comparing intensity-modulated radiotherapy (IMRT) with 3-dimensonal conformal radiotherapy (3DCRT) for the treatment of prostate cancer on a hypofractionated schedule. METHODS: The authors randomly assigned 215 men who had localized prostate cancer to receive hypofractionated radiotherapy to a total dose of 70 grays (Gy) in 25 fractions (at 2.8 Gy per fraction) using either IMRT or 3DCRT. Acute and late gastrointestinal (GI) and genitourinary (GU) toxicity were prospectively evaluated according to modified Radiation Therapy Oncology Group criteria. Biochemical control was defined according to the Phoenix criteria (prostate-specific antigen nadir + 2 ng/mL). RESULTS: In total, 215 patients were enrolled in the IMRT group (n = 109) or the 3DCRT group (n = 106). The 3DCRT arm had a 27% rate of grade ≥ 2 acute GU toxicity compared with a 9% rate in the IMRT arm (P = .001) and a 24% rate of grade ≥ 2 acute GI toxicity compared with a 7% rate in the IMRT arm (P = .001). The maximal rate of grade ≥2 late GU toxicity during the entire period of follow-up was 3.7% in the IMRT group versus 12.3% in the 3DCRT group (P = .02). The maximal rate of grade ≥2 late GI toxicity during the entire follow-up was 6.4% in the IMRT group versus 21.7% in the 3DCRT group (P = .001). The 5-year rate of freedom from biochemical failure was 95.4% in the IMRT arm and 94.3% in the 3DCRT arm (P = .678). CONCLUSIONS: IMRT reduced the delivery of significant radiation doses to the bladder and rectum using a similar target volume. This dosimetric advantage resulted in a lower rate of acute/late grade ≥ 2 GI and GU toxicity for IMRT compared with 3DCRT. Cancer 2016;122:2004-11. © 2016 American Cancer Society.

PURPOSE: To find a high-risk group of supraclavicular fossa recurrence (SCFR) in N1 breast cancer treated with breast conservative therapy without supraclavicular radiation therapy (SCFRT). METHODS AND MATERIALS: We designed a retrospective review of 767 patients with N1 breast cancer. All patients included in this study underwent to lumpectomy or quadrantectomy with axillary lymph node dissection, followed by whole breast irradiation. All patients received radiotherapy with two tangencial fields, after a median dose of 50.4 Gy on the whole breast; an additional boost (10-16 Gy) to the tumor bed was administered. A analysis by the cox method was performed to identify prognostic factors for SCFR and a risk group for SCFR was build. RESULTS: With a median follow-up of 76 months (12-142 months), 81 patients (10.5%) had SCFR. With the exception of T stage, all other prognostic factors (lymphovascular invasion, extracapsular extension, the number of involved axillary nodes, estrogen receptor, T stage and nuclear grade) maintaned a statistical significance in the multivariate analysis. The risk group build consisted of patients with 1 or none prognostic factor, 2 and 3 or more prognostic factors. In the analysis of 5-years SCFR free survival, patients with ≥ 3 factors showed a significant higher recurrence rate than patients with 2 and 1 or none factors 44.1%, 91.1% and 97.7%, (p < 0.0001) respectively. CONCLUSIONS: Extracapsular extension, lymphovascular invasion, high nuclear grade, negative hormone receptor and the number of involved axillary nodes were important prognostic factors associated with SCFR.
